What Is Cantilever Atomic Force Microscope. The atomic force microscope (afm) performs surface sensing by using a cantilever (an element that is made of a rigid block like a beam or plate, that attaches to the end of support, from which it protrudes making a perpendicularly flat connection that is vertical like a wall). As shown, a laser is reflected from the back of a cantilever that includes the afm.
